What Is a FICO Loan Savings Calculator?

A FICO loan savings calculator is an online financial tool that estimates how much money you could save on loans by improving your credit score. It compares interest rates based on credit score ranges and shows potential savings in:

  • Monthly payments
  • Total loan interest
  • Overall repayment cost

These calculators help borrowers make smarter financial decisions by understanding the impact of credit scores.

Why Your FICO Score Matters for Loans

Your FICO score is a numerical representation of your creditworthiness. Lenders use it to decide:

  • Whether to approve a loan
  • What interest rate to offer
  • Loan terms and conditions

How a FICO Loan Savings Calculator Works

Most calculators use a simple comparison method.

Step 1: Enter Loan Details

You typically input:

  • Loan amount
  • Loan duration
  • Current credit score range
  • Expected improved score

Step 2: Interest Rate Comparison

The calculator estimates interest rates based on credit score categories.

Step 3: Savings Calculation

It then calculates:

  • Monthly payment difference
  • Total interest saved
  • Potential long-term savings

This gives a clear financial picture.

Tips to Improve Your FICO Score

Tips to Improve Your FICO Score

Improving your credit score increases potential savings.

Pay Bills On Time

Payment history significantly affects credit scores.

Reduce Credit Card Balances

Lower credit utilization improves scores.

Avoid Frequent Credit Applications

Too many inquiries can lower scores.

Monitor Your Credit Report

Check regularly for errors.

Maintain Long Credit History

Older accounts strengthen credit profile.

Credit Score Ranges Explained

Understanding score ranges helps interpret results.

Typical ranges:

  • 300–579 → Poor
  • 580–669 → Fair
  • 670–739 → Good
  • 740–799 → Very Good
  • 800+ → Excellent

Better scores usually mean better loan terms.
